To folks who will someday do the same, as few bits 'o advise for getting along with folks in close quarters. 1.) Do NOT move in at 11:45 p.m. This will really p*ss your new neighbors off. 2.) Sound carries, especially the bass from steros. If you want to figure out if your stuff is too loud, put it on. Pick up your keys and go into the hallway. Shut the door. If you can hear it, it's WAY too loud and will make other folks unhappy. 3.) TV home theaters do not belong in building with shared walls....EVER. 4.) Leaving your stinky garbage in the hall is just gross, and makes folks think wolves would have done a better job raisin' you than your folks apparently did. 5.) If your pet poops in the hallway...Clean It Up. (see #4.) 6.) If your roommate/boyfriend/girlfriend won't let you in at 2am, do not lean on someone else's buzzer unless you want said buzzer inserted rectally. 7.) Do not walk away from the electric stove if you're frying/deep frying something. It's a recipie for burning the building down. As a matter of fact, when doing that kind of cooking, keep the fire extinguisher handy. Or lots of flour. Do not use water. 8.) Do not practice with your garage band in your apartment. There is a reason it's called a garage band. Go find a garage....far away. 9.) Don't decide to put nails in the walls after 8pm. 10.) Unless you're on the bottom floor, jumping jacks are right out.
